    Please say hello to Ben the bichon!

    Our house and hearts felt so empty after the loss of Leo that we decided to rescue another little dog in need of a home. This is Ben ( originally Frisou) He is a three year old ( just) xbichon/maltese and very small at 9lbs.

    We went to a large rescue event last week ( Ten different rescuesthis area has lots of puppymills) and met him there. He is very friendly and was not at all bothered by the dozens of dogs and people attending the event. We filled in a very long and detailed application and got a call back next day. The ladies came out to inspect us and the home and decided we were suitable "parents" for this little boy!

    He had been living in NO PETS building in a very small apartment with two very old people and was never taken for a walk. Consequently he got cabin fever and barked all the time!

    After living with a lovely foster family for a while he has learned to love walks and other dogs although he will still need help learning not to pull on the leash. He had never been trained to pee etc outside so that is something to learn too. He is very clean though and uses his puppy pad every time.

    He loves to play in the snow even though in places it is deeper than he is tall! His only worry now is that he is afraid of the cat Napoleon has made attempts to be friendly and is not at all aggressive except for a quick chase if he gets a cold nose in his private places We are sure everything will settle down quite soon and they will be friends.

    The rescue ladies are very thorough and particular ( which is great) and answer any questions we might have . I have offered to volunteer with them and am looking forward to doing so.
